Output 150864f58ba9d2e680d986cdd5ae74fd43406041fc92a951aa7e940e919c1a6a:1

value
5330360
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2cbb6c7a945e8a2b1a2b25779e37af7075dd2fea OP_EQUALVERIFY OP_CHECKSIG
address
155XFsVvsTFC1fa3KqU7okJ88CxSBJEifv
transaction
150864f58ba9d2e680d986cdd5ae74fd43406041fc92a951aa7e940e919c1a6a
confirmations
302480
spent
true